diff --git a/packages/discord.js/typings/index.d.ts b/packages/discord.js/typings/index.d.ts index bc2515e37..8e26d9b63 100644 --- a/packages/discord.js/typings/index.d.ts +++ b/packages/discord.js/typings/index.d.ts @@ -3518,17 +3518,17 @@ export class ShardClientUtil { public mode: ShardingManagerMode; public parentPort: MessagePort | null; public broadcastEval(fn: (client: Client) => Awaitable): Promise[]>; - public broadcastEval( - fn: (client: Client) => Awaitable, - options: { shard: number }, + public broadcastEval( + fn: (client: Client, context: Serialized) => Awaitable, + options: { context: Context; shard: number }, ): Promise>; public broadcastEval( fn: (client: Client, context: Serialized) => Awaitable, options: { context: Context }, ): Promise[]>; - public broadcastEval( - fn: (client: Client, context: Serialized) => Awaitable, - options: { context: Context; shard: number }, + public broadcastEval( + fn: (client: Client) => Awaitable, + options: { shard: number }, ): Promise>; public fetchClientValues(prop: string): Promise; public fetchClientValues(prop: string, shard: number): Promise; @@ -3554,17 +3554,17 @@ export class ShardingManager extends EventEmitter { public shardList: number[] | 'auto'; public broadcast(message: unknown): Promise; public broadcastEval(fn: (client: Client) => Awaitable): Promise[]>; - public broadcastEval( - fn: (client: Client) => Awaitable, - options: { shard: number }, + public broadcastEval( + fn: (client: Client, context: Serialized) => Awaitable, + options: { context: Context; shard: number }, ): Promise>; public broadcastEval( fn: (client: Client, context: Serialized) => Awaitable, options: { context: Context }, ): Promise[]>; - public broadcastEval( - fn: (client: Client, context: Serialized) => Awaitable, - options: { context: Context; shard: number }, + public broadcastEval( + fn: (client: Client) => Awaitable, + options: { shard: number }, ): Promise>; public createShard(id: number): Shard; public fetchClientValues(prop: string): Promise;